The Department of Social Welfare and Development (DSWD) received educational tablets from MSN Foundation, Inc., the corporate foundation of Cherry Mobile, intended for high school and college students in the DSWD Regional Rehabilitation Center for Youth (RRCY) in Guimaras.

DSWD Secretary Rolando Joselito D. Bautista and Assistant Secretary for Specialized Programs Rhea B. Peñaflor received the donation from Cherry Mobile Philippines Corporate Social Responsibility Manager Regin Anacay in a simple turnover ceremony held at the DSWD Central Office on November 27, 2020.

The donation, composed of 17 Cherry Mobile tablets worth P3,500 each, was made possible by MSN Foundation’s partnership with Ms. Heart Evangelista-Escudero under the “BIG Heart Ph” project.

The partnership aims to provide necessary educational tool for indigent students to help them cope with the demands of the new modality of learning.

Aside from receiving tablet units, the beneficiaries will also be provided with internet access through Cherry Mobile’s CMSURF 50 promo.

DSWD’s RRCY provides prevention, diversion, and rehabilitation services to help children in conflict with the law (CICL) become citizens who contribute positively to the country. RRCY Guimaras is one of the 15 centers maintained by DSWD serving CICL.
